Phrasal verbs starting with "line"

5 phrasal verbs use this verb

line in
B2

A technical audio/electronics term referring to the input socket used to receive an external audio signal directly into a device.

line off
B2

To separate or mark off a section or area with a drawn or painted line.

line out
B2

To arrange in a line; a specific restart method in rugby; or an audio output signal connection.

line up
A2

To stand or place things in a row; to organise or arrange people, events, or plans; to be scheduled or positioned.

line up behind
B2

To give one's support to a person, plan, or cause, especially in a group or organised way.
